Ford is shutting down production of the Focus ST

The beginning of 2025 showed that Ford in Europe is not even close to getting out of the crisis that has been going on for a long time. The rapid transition to all-electric cars and the discontinuation of some models were a gamble. Everything started collapsing like a house of cards, and the latest information says that even the Focus ST will no longer be on offer.

Maybe this is a surprise for some, but let’s remember that Ford has already announced that the production of the Focus will end in November. However, no one could have expected that this could be the end for the sports version as well. How smart this move is remains to be seen, and anyone interested can order the latest examples in European Ford dealerships.

The current Ford Focus ST is powered by a 2.3-L Ecoboost four-cylinder turbo petrol engine with 280 hp and 420 Nm of torque, mated to a 6-speed manual or 7-speed automatic transmission that sends power to the front wheels. It acc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 5.7 seconds with a top speed of 250 km/h.

Whether the American company will change its mind and introduce a successor in the near future is currently unknown.

Ford Focus ST with m365 Mountune kit

Officially, the fourth-generation Ford Focus RS is not coming this year. So, the British company Mountune upgraded the Ford Focus ST with the M365 kit.

Thanks to the M365 kit, the ST’s 2.3-liter four-cylinder engine delivers 365 hp and 413 lb-ft (560 Nm) of torque. The ST M365 has a six-speed manual transmission and front-wheel drive. The Focus ST offers two driving modes: Sport and Track.

The increase in power of 82 hp and 102 lb-ft (140 Nm) of torque, compared to the standard ST, was achieved thanks to hardware upgrades, improved exhaust system, remapping of the ECU. Remapping is done via the SMARTflash app, and all you need is a smartphone and a Bluetooth OBD interface. This power boost will cost you $ 800 (€ 700).

With all the upgrades, the engine produces enough juice for the ST to reach a top speed of 155 mph (250 km / h). The car underwent long tests that included tens of thousands of kilometers, endurance test and collection of various data.

With a weight of 3325 pounds (1508 kg) and improved performance, the ST has reached the Focus RS level.
